本課題采用php作為設計開發語言,實現一個的民族服飾服裝商城平臺的的設計與開發。實現用戶從瀏覽服飾,搜索服飾,加入購物車,下訂單,評論服飾一整個購物流程的功能。主要完成六個模塊內容:
注冊登錄模塊:身份驗證。
用戶個人信息模塊:用戶個人信息的修改。
服飾搜索模塊:根據指定條件搜索物品。
服飾展示模塊:展示服飾信息。
訂單模塊:對服飾下訂單,購買后進行評論。
后臺管理模塊:通過對服飾進行增加或刪除等管理。
構想與思路是:
(1)本設計采用B/S架構,使用戶可以采用不同的設備訪問系統。
(2)使用mvc設計模式,實現控制與數據分離,便于功能拓展,提高程序的可維護性。
(3)使用mysql作為數據存儲系統。
(4)使用php為后臺設計語言。
(5)使用html+css+js語言制作頁面。
可能出現的工作難點以及擬解決的方法:
開發工具(Zend Studio,Notepad++7.3.1,PhpStorm,Dreamweaver):
注冊信息驗證問題:
問題描述:在用戶注冊時,用戶名在本系統是唯一的,用戶可能輸入了重復的用戶名,或者輸入格式不正確,比如說手機號碼格式不正確,非法的郵箱地址,用戶密碼強度不夠等等。所以要對用戶輸入的信息進行校驗,如果不合規范,則不發送請求到后臺,減少了沒必要的網絡資源浪費。
解決方案:用戶名重復問題只能發送請求到后臺處理,查詢數據庫中是否已存在此用戶名了,如果存在,則提醒用戶重新輸入。
1.注冊登錄模塊:新用戶必須通過注冊賬號設置密碼才能進入網購物,老用戶可以直接輸入賬號密碼登錄。
2.信息管理模塊:新用戶注冊后需編輯用戶信息(姓名、性別等),系統也隨時提供用戶信息修改功能。
3.信息查看模塊:提供訂單、月賬單、瀏覽記錄查看功能,也可以刪除清空這些記錄。
4.首頁展示模塊:全網商品搜索欄、民族服飾修改、個性化智能推薦用戶可能喜歡的商品模塊。
5.聊天評價模塊:用戶可與其感興趣的商品所在的商家聊天溝通,也可以在購買后評價該商品。
6.購物車模塊:用戶可先把喜歡的商品加入購物車,等待瀏覽完后在購物車里一鍵購買所有商品,并且提供刪除、清空購物車功能。
上一篇:高校人事管理系統
下一篇:基于php的二手車交易網站